Booklet outlining the construction and use of the British Refracting Unit (BRU) including preliminary questioning, retinoscopy, subjective testing, measuring phorias by Maddox test or Duplicating Prism method, measurement of ductions, use of crossed-cylinders. Black and white illustrations of the unit, its accessories (including various drum charts and the F-L chart), the Pulzone hydraulic chair and the operation of controls (including p.d. adjustment, rotating the spherical lenses, the cylindrical batteries, crossed-cylinders, Stevens' phorometer, Risley rotary prisms and use of the +1.50 D lens in retinoscopy. Also instructions for cleaning the lenses. 19 pages. Stiff cover.
